Opening ceremony
The laying of the wreath at the bust of founder Charles P. Adams officially kicks of the Founder’s Week observance Monday morning. Sharing wreath duties are Steven Wilson, Student Government Association president, Miss GSU 2019-2020 Rickinzie Johnikin, and Grambling State President Rick Gallot.
